Princeton had lost seven straight on the road dating back to last season, but on Tuesday they dropped down to 3-7 to make it eight. They fell just short of the McKinney Lions by a score of 6-5. The result was an unpleasant reminder to the Panthers of the 3-0 loss they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ture back in March of 2025.
As for McKinney, with the victory, they broke their three-game losing streak and moved their record to 9-7-1.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est win they have posted since March 7, 2025.
For McKinney's part, the team relied heavily on Rodger Washington, who went 2-for-4 with one stolen base, two RBI, and one run. That's the most hits Washington has posted since back in February of 2025.
While Princeton had to take the loss, they won't have to wait long to give it another shot: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 7:30 p.m. on Friday.
